Newcastle United have reportedly joined Manchester United in the race to sign Inter Milan midfielder Marcelo Brozovic.



The Croatian has eight months remaining on his contract with the Nerazzurri, and they have failed to convince him to extend his deal.

He can sign a pre-contract with a foreign club in January and it appears that the Magpies could compete with United for his services.

The Red Devils are keen to find a replacement for Paul Pogba, who could leave them on a free transfer when his contract expires next summer.

Brozovic is one of the top names on their radar, but the Magpies are ready to provide competition following their Saudi-led takeover.

The Tyneside outfit have ambitious plans after the change of ownership, and there could be significant spending in the near future.

However, there are doubts whether players would be willing to join them at the current point of time when they are battling relegation.

The club are currently six points adrift of safety. The hierarchy are expected to address the concern with high-profile signings in January.
